The stories and art of famed graphic novelist and filmmaker Enki Bilal adapted for an immersive, richly detailed adventure game for the PC
Got Game Entertainment announced today it has signed Nikopol: Secrets of the Immortals, an adventure game developed by Benoît Sokal's White Birds Productions and adapted from the famed "Nikopol Trilogy" graphic novel series, and major film release "Immortal", by Enki Bilal. The game immerses players in a futuristic Paris and the tale of a son's search for his father and ultimate journey into the perilous world of political intrigue. As Nikopol, players must use cunning and puzzle-solving logic to thwart a dark conspiracy. Nikopol: Secrets of the Immortals is due to ship in North America in August 2008 and will retail for $29.99 (USD) - fifteen screenshots have been added in our gallery.
